Oscillators are electronic devices that produce an output signal with a waveform that is periodic in nature by using the frequency and amplitude parameters. They generate AC signals out of DC signals, the output frequency can be constant or set over a certain range. Oscillators are employed across various industries in applications where an accurate or controlled frequency is needed.
